在下行写出使元素水平居中的声明代码
时间: 2024-02-16 07:05:05 浏览: 15
要使元素水平居中,可以使用以下 CSS 声明:
```css
.element {
margin: 0 auto;
}
```
上面的代码将会使 `.element` 元素水平居中。`margin: 0 auto` 表示上下边距为 0,左右边距自动平分剩余空间,从而实现水平居中。
需要注意的是,这种方法仅适用于块级元素。对于行内元素,可以将元素的 `display` 属性设置为 `inline-block` 或 `inline-flex`,然后再使用 `text-align` 属性将其包含的内容水平居中。例如:
```css
.element {
display: inline-block;
text-align: center;
}
```
上面的代码将会使 `.element` 元素及其内容水平居中。
相关问题
写出基于5G下行主同步信号的频偏估计的matlab代码
当然,我可以为您提供一个基于5G下行主同步信号的频偏估计的matlab代码,示例代码如下:
```matlab
% 读取下行主同步信号
[syncSignal, Fs] = audioread('sync_signal.wav');
% 解调信号
syncSignal = syncSignal .* exp(-1i * 2 * pi * Fs / 4);
% 计算FFT参数
N = length(syncSignal);
f = (-N / 2 : N / 2 - 1) * Fs / N;
% 进行FFT
syncSignal_fft = fftshift(fft(syncSignal));
% 找到频率峰值
[~, idx] = max(abs(syncSignal_fft));
freqPeak = f(idx);
% 计算频偏
freqOffset = freqPeak - 15e3;
% 输出结果
disp(['频偏为:' num2str(freqOffset) ' Hz']);
```
需要注意的是,该示例代码仅供参考,实际应用中可能需要根据具体情况进行调整。同时,该代码假设5G下行主同步信号的中心频率为15kHz,如果不是,请根据实际情况进行调整。
VUE中下行内元素和块级元素的区别?
在 Vue 中,下行内元素和块级元素的区别与 HTML 中的下行内元素和块级元素的区别类似。
- 块级元素:会独占一行,可以设置宽度、高度、内边距和外边距等属性,并且可以嵌套其他块级元素或下行内元素。
- 下行内元素:不会独占一行,它的宽度和高度由内容决定,不能设置宽度和高度,但可以设置内边距和外边距等属性,并且可以嵌套其他下行内元素。
在 Vue 的模板中,可以使用`<span>`标签来创建下行内元素,使用`<div>`标签来创建块级元素。例如:
```html
<template>
<div class="container">
<h1>这是一个块级元素</h1>
<p>这是一个块级元素</p>
<span>这是一个下行内元素</span>
<span>这是一个下行内元素</span>
</div>
</template>
```
在这个例子中,`<h1>`和`<p>`标签是块级元素,它们会独占一行;`<span>`标签是下行内元素,它们不会独占一行。